WebApr 20, 2024 · Not everyone graduates at the same pace and according to recent statistics, only 19% of students at graduates within the standard 4 years. Even the top universities with higher graduation rates only see 36% of the students graduating within this standard timeframe. So, taking 5 years or more to graduate is not bad, even for grad school. primed shiplap siding

Web“I graduated” is correct when you are using it to refer to graduating in the past. It’s a good choice because it allows you to show that you had successfully achieved your degree without needing to be specific about any time when that took place. You don’t need any auxiliary verbs when using the past tense in this way.
